Understanding Rebates

Before diving into the process of asking for a rebate, it’s essential to understand what rebates are and how they work. A rebate is a refund or discount on a purchase, usually offered by the manufacturer or retailer as a promotional strategy to encourage sales. Rebates can be found on a wide range of products, from electronics and home appliances to cosmetics and clothing. They are often advertised alongside the product, either in-store, on the product’s packaging, or on the company’s website. The process typically involves purchasing the product at full price and then submitting a claim to receive a partial refund.

Types of Rebates

There are several types of rebates available, each with its unique characteristics and requirements. Mail-in rebates are one of the most common types, where consumers mail in a form along with a receipt and other required documents to receive their rebate. Instant rebates offer a discount at the time of purchase, eliminating the need for a mail-in process. Digital rebates, on the other hand, are processed online, making the claim process faster and more convenient.

Preparing to Ask for a Rebate

Requesting a rebate requires some preparation to ensure the process is smooth and successful. The first step is to carefully read and understand the rebate terms and conditions. Manufacturers often set specific criteria that must be met to be eligible for a rebate, such as purchasing the product within a certain time frame or buying it from an authorized retailer. It’s also crucial to keep all relevant documents, including receipts, product packaging, and any other required materials, as these will be necessary when submitting your rebate claim.

Gathering Necessary Documents

To ask for a rebate, you will typically need to provide proof of purchase. This can include:

  • Receipts showing the date and amount of purchase
  • The product’s Universal Product Code (UPC) or barcode
  • Completed rebate forms, which can usually be found on the product’s packaging or the manufacturer’s website
  • Any other documentation specified by the rebate offer

Asking for a Rebate

With all the necessary documents and information in hand, the next step is to submit your rebate claim. This process can usually be completed online through the manufacturer’s website or by mailing in the required documents.

Submitting Your Claim Online

For digital rebates, the process is relatively straightforward. You will need to visit the manufacturer’s website, navigate to the rebate section, and fill out the online rebate form. Make sure to attach all required documents and double-check that all information is accurate before submitting your claim.

Submitting Your Claim by Mail

If you are dealing with a mail-in rebate, you will need to fill out the rebate form carefully and attach all the required documents. It’s a good idea to make a copy of your submission for your records before mailing it to the specified address. Ensure that your submission is postmarked within the deadline specified by the rebate offer to be eligible.

After Submitting Your Rebate Claim

After submitting your rebate claim, it’s essential to keep track of your claim’s status. Many manufacturers and retailers provide online tools or customer service numbers that allow you to check on the status of your rebate. If there are any issues with your claim, such as missing documents or incorrect information, you will typically be notified and given the opportunity to rectify the situation.

What are common reasons for rebate claim rejections?

Common reasons for rebate claim rejections include missing or incomplete documentation, expired or invalid rebates, and failure to meet the rebate terms and conditions. Customers may also experience rejections due to incorrect or incomplete contact information, which can prevent the rebate processor from verifying the claim. Additionally, customers who do not submit their rebate claims within the specified timeframe or fail to provide required proofs of purchase may also experience rejections.

To minimize the risk of rebate claim rejection, customers should carefully review the rebate terms and conditions and ensure they understand the requirements for claiming the rebate. It is also essential to double-check the rebate application and supporting documents for completeness and accuracy before submitting the claim. If a rebate claim is rejected, customers can contact the rebate processor to understand the reason for the rejection and resubmit their claim with the required corrections or documentation.
